Im a Utd fan !!! it was such a dull boring lifeless no clue game I would have imagined you would have nodded off after 5 minutes.

Although it did come to life for about 20 seconds after Paul Scholes was sent off (he is poor these days, no longer the Ginger Magician thats for sure), there was a burst of energy from Giggsy but as soon as we lost possesion (something that happened far too often all night and to be fair in most of the games we participate in these days) we reverted to playing ****e where o where have the waves of attacking football gone, we resemble Liverpool and their long ball game at the moment.

If Lille were that rubbish why didnt Rossi Start, if it wasn't working then revert to the 4-5-1, Ruud must have been seriously pissed off, he worked his nuts off for no end result, Fletcher was awful at times as was a lot of the passing in midfield I dont see Fletch turning into a Gerrard or Lampard that's for sure even though Fergie thinks he's the new Scottish saviour he has never set a game alight, he has the odd moment, he's never dominated a game and never will , get Ballack and AN Other for the midfield soonest!!
